Monroe

Although it's largely residential, Monroe blends industrial grit and old-fashioned living: it's the birthplace of Velveeta as well as home to Museum Village, a living-history museum. The town offers dining just off Exit 130 of Route 17 (morphing into Interstate 86, the Quickway), which makes it a relatively convenient place to eat near Harriman State Park and Sterling Forest.
